Tarkett has secured CDP's prestigious "A" rating for climate action, placing it among the top 2% of over 24,800 companies worldwide. This achievement marks the latest in a series of sustainability recognitions for the flooring leader, including a Platinum EcoVadis Medal.

After 14 years of building the Schönox brand across the U.S. flooring industry, TMT America sells its ownership stake to Sika Corporation, marking a strategic transition for both companies.

The Spanish ceramic tile sector showed signs of stabilization in 2024 with slight increases in production, domestic sales, and employment despite a 0.9% drop in overall turnover to €4.819 billion [U.S. $5.24 billion]. Exports remain dominant at 72% of sales, with the United States as the top market.
